As a Senior Bridge Lead based in Calgary, Alberta you will be responsible for providing technical leadership and managing a variety of small to large-scale high-profile public structural engineering projects, focusing on the design and delivery of bridges, overpasses, and related infrastructure. The role will be challenging, interesting, varied, and offer significant opportunities for skill set and career development. You will be required to work within a growing team environment carrying out feasibility, assessment, design, project engineering/management and construction support services on a large variety of bridge and other structural engineering assignments.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Planning, organizing, and working with technical groups in the delivery of project requirements.
  • Design of bridges and facilities for public and private infrastructure including roadways, heavy rail, light rail, pedestrian bridges, retaining walls, foundations, and buildings.
  • Manage and mentor multidisciplinary project teams, providing leadership, technical direction, and fostering a collaborative environment.
  • Involvement in project management of structural engineering projects.
  • Ensure projects are well managed and controlled, and meet required performance, safety and business standards.
  • Act as a technical lead and engineer of record for bridge projects, providing expert guidance on all technical aspects of the design process.
  • Develop, review, and approve technical designs, reports, and specifications for a variety of projects.
  • Prepare of construction cost estimates, ensuring accurate budgeting and financial management throughout project execution.
  • Support and contribute to strategic initiatives, and long-term business growth goals.
  • Lead business development activities, including proposal preparation, client presentations, and identifying new project opportunities.
  • Ensure compliance with Alberta Transportation design standards and other relevant local, provincial, and national guidelines and codes.
  • Develop and maintain strong relationships with clients, contractors, regulatory agencies, and other stakeholders.
  • Foster a positive, safe, and inclusive team environment, ensuring adherence to company policies and safety standards.
  • Mentoring and development of technical staff.

Required Skills &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ree from a recognized and accredited University in Civil Engineering with a focus on Structural Engineering.
  • P.Eng. registered with APEGA, or eligible for professional registration in Alberta.
  • Experience with Alberta Transportation design standards, specifications, and deliverable requirements for bridge and roadway projects.
  • Strong technical expertise in bridge design, including structural analysis, material selection, and construction techniques.
  • Excellent communicator and skilled problem solver with a commitment to thrive in a proactive organization where client service is paramount.
  • Excellent written and oral communication skills with the ability to convey complex technical information to clients, stakeholders, and team members.
  • Demonstrated ability to support and contribute to a positive team environment.
  • Business development experience and a demonstrated ability to build and maintain client relationships is highly desirable.
  •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, dynamic work environment with shifting priorities and tight deadlines.
